Biohaven Outlook - Navigating a Volatile Path Amid Weak Technicals

Generated by AI AgentData DriverReviewed byTianhao Xu
Thursday, Nov 6, 2025 4:16 pm ET2min read
Aime RobotAime Summary

-

(BHVN.N) shares fell 48.83% amid weak technical signals and conflicting analyst ratings.

- Regulatory uncertainty from new FDA leadership and Trump’s drug pricing order heighten market risks.

- Institutional investors show cautious optimism with 50.93% inflow ratio, but technical indicators suggest bearish dominance.

- Analysts’ mixed views (Strong Buy vs. Neutral) contrast with sharp price declines, advising caution until clarity emerges.

```htmlMarket SnapshotHeadline Takeaway: (BHVN.N) is experiencing a significant price decline of -48.83% and faces a mixed analytical outlook with weak technical signals and conflicting analyst ratings.
News HighlightsRecent headlines paint a picture of a volatile market environment, with implications for Biohaven: New FDA Leadership Could Raise The Bar For Drug Approvals (May 2025): Regulatory uncertainty looms large, especially for biotech firms like Biohaven. Expect stock volatility around key FDA decisions. Pharma is facing its nightmare scenario (May 2025): President Trump’s executive order on drug pricing has sparked widespread concern. Biohaven, like other pharma firms, could face tighter profit margins and slower R&D timelines. Biosimilars Regulatory Roundup (May 2025): Recent FDA approvals for biosimilars indicate a shift toward affordable treatment options. This could impact Biohaven’s market positioning if it doesn’t adapt quickly.Analyst Views & FundamentalsAnalysts have shown minimal confidence in Biohaven’s near-term prospects: Average Rating Score (Simple Mean): 4.00 (based on two analysts). Weighted Rating Score (Performance-Weighted): 0.00, as historical performance of analysts has been poor. Rating Consistency: Dispersed — one analyst rates “Strong Buy,” while another rates “Neutral.” Alignment with Price Trend: The average rating is neutral to optimistic, but the stock price has fallen sharply (-48.83%), suggesting analysts’ views are not reflected in the market.Key fundamental values were not available for this analysis.Money-Flow TrendsBig money is still cautiously optimistic about Biohaven, with inflow ratios across all investor categories trending in a positive direction: Small Investors: 52.65% inflow ratio. Medium Investors: 49.14% inflow ratio. Large Investors: 51.31% inflow ratio. Extra-Large Investors: 51.20% inflow ratio. Overall Inflow Ratio: 50.93%. Block Inflow Ratio: 51.22%.With an internal diagnostic score of 7.94/10, this suggests that large and institutional players are showing interest — a positive sign for future momentum, though retail sentiment is also mixed.Key Technical SignalsThe technical outlook for Biohaven is weak, as indicated by the internal diagnostic technical score of 3.86/10. The chart shows a dominance of bearish signals: WR Overbought: Internal score of 1.00/10 — weak signal, historically associated with -5.1% average returns. Long Upper Shadow: Score 1.00/10 — bearish pattern observed 26 times historically with -4.9% average returns. WR Oversold: Score 3.86/10 — neutral signal, with a 54.41% win rate. Bullish Harami Cross: Strong signal with score 8.07/10 — historically associated with 5.23% returns in 2 instances. MACD Death Cross: Score 5.38/10 — neutral signal with 57.14% win rate.Recent chart activity (Nov 3, 2025): Long Upper Shadow, WR Oversold, and MACD Death Cross appeared simultaneously — a mixed signal with potential for volatility.Key Insight: Momentum is unclear, and the bearish indicators (3) are outweighing the bullish ones (1). Investors are advised to avoid the stock until clarity emerges.ConclusionBiohaven is currently navigating a turbulent landscape marked by weak technical signals and conflicting analyst views. While institutional money shows tentative optimism, the technical indicators suggest caution. Given the internal diagnostic technical score of 3.86/10, it may be wise for most investors to **consider avoiding Biohaven for now** and wait for a clearer trend or better alignment of technical and fundamental signals before entering a position.```

Comments



Add a public comment...
No comments

No comments yet